About Argentina

Geography

South American country

 

8th largest in the world by land area

Bordering countries

Chile to the west, Bolivia to the north, Paraguay to the north-east, Brazil to the east, Uruguay to the north-east & south Atlantic ocean to the east.

Capital

Buenos Aires (largest city) – it is famous for its rich cultural heritage, architecture etc.

Other major cities

Rosario, Mendoza, La Plata, Cordoba

Population

Over 45 million people, 2nd most populous country in south America. Majority of the population is of European descent. They are primarily of Spanish & Italian origin.

Official language

Spanish

Government

Federal, republic, presidential, multi-party system

Physiography

Andes mountain, Patagonia glaciers, Iguazu falls, Pampas grassland

Economy

One of the Rich in natural resources, agriculture, manufacturing

Major exports: Beef, wheat, soybeans

Challenges: high inflation

High quality wines of Mendoza are famous worldwide.

Buenos Aires Stock Exchange is one of the most prominent financial markets in the region.

Culture

Tango music & dance originated in Argentina.

Football (soccer) is very famous here. World-famous football players like Maradona, Messi belong to Argentina.

Recent events

Severe economic crisis in the form of inflation & debt issues. As a result, Argentine Peso was devalued.

Their climate change policy is controversial since they are planning to withdraw from the Paris climate change.

Argentina has already downgraded its Environment ministry. They have susupended the funds allocated for forest protection.

Q. The Perito Moreno Glacier is located in which Argentine national park?

A) Tierra del Fuego National Park

B) Laguna Blanca National Park

C) Los Glaciares National Park

D) Talampaya National Park

Answer: C) Los Glaciares National Park

Los Glaciares National Park is located in Santa Cruz Province, Patagonia, Argentina.

It is a UNESCO World Heritage Site and home to multiple glaciers, including the famous Perito Moreno Glacier, which is one of the few advancing glaciers in the world.
